The Paleo Theater is packed with cheering fans ready for a dance showdown. When the beat drops, can Triceratops win over the judges with his pop and lock? Can Allo's on-pointe ballet moves dominate the solo category? And will Maia and Stego take home the top prize for their sizzling salsa steps? This prehistoric dance competition will keep you on the edge of your seat! Dinosaurs face off in prehistoric sports competitions—from baseball to wrestling and every sport in between! Will the plant-eaters become the champions? Or will the meat-eaters be victorious? Fast-paced, rhyming commentary and exuberant illustrations put readers right in the action. Sure to thrill dinosaur lovers and sports fans alike!

      Wheeler and Gott have presented Dino-Baseball, Dino-Racing, and more; why not a dino dance-off? Here, numerous dinosaurs compete, performing various dances ("Allosaurus is up on her toes: / Scarlet tutu, crimson hose"). Several rhymes miss a step, but readers will stay entertained by the slick, swirly-and-twirly art and the competition angle, and they won't fret the outcome: Wheeler doesn't play favorites.
